Good evening, Iโm your host Arthurleson with a space update. New evidence suggests ancient Mars may have been a planet of rivers rather than the barren desert it is today. Researchers trained a computer model on Mars rover images and found landforms consistent with river erosion. This indicates there could be a lot more undiscovered river deposits out there. The findings paint a more optimistic view for past Martian life. Flowing water is so critical for life on Earth, so ancient Mars rivers likely supported more habitable conditions and nutrient cycles. Between this and the delta that Perseverance is exploring, it seems olโ Red may have been a waterworld back in the day. Of course, we still have more geologic mysteries to unpack. But evidence keeps stacking up that Mars was once a lush, flowing planet ripe for little alien microbes to thrive. Maybe weโll even find fossilized remains in an ancient streambed one day.
